. The Robinsons and their kin folk. MRS. ALMIRA PIERCE JOHNSONMilford, Mass. Born, June 24, 1804 Died, December 25, 1905 Aged, 101 years, 6 months, 1 day Secretarys Report. N the morning of the 19th day of August, 1904,the Robinsons and their Kin Folk gathered in theold historic town of Plymouth, Mass., to hold thethird biennial meeting of The Robinson FamilyGenealogical and Historical Association, wherelanded that little band of Pilgrims with the bless-ing of their beloved pastor, the Rev. John Robin-son of Leyden, two hundred and eighty-fourt years little band of pioneers builded better than they knew,laying not only the foundation of a mighty nation, but made itpossible for this notable gathering of the Kin Folk to-day. The meeting was held in the lecture room of the UniversalistChurch, whose doors were hospitably thrown open for thisoccasion. The members of the Executive Committee met at ten oclock,•and at eleven oclock the Association was called to order by thePresident, Hon. David I. Robinson of Gloucester, Mass., andled in prayer by the Rev. Lucian Moore Robinson of Phila-delphia, Pa. On motion, Ebenezer T. Robinson, M. D., of Orange
